diff --git a/app/electron/error.html b/app/electron/error.html
index 435baf781..0f7e4285a 100644
--- a/app/electron/error.html
+++ b/app/electron/error.html
@@ -182,12 +182,12 @@
})
document.getElementById('close').addEventListener('click', () => {
- const {getCurrentWindow} = require('@electron/remote')
- getCurrentWindow().destroy()
+ const {ipcRenderer} = require('electron')
+ ipcRenderer.send("siyuan-cmd", "destroy");
})
document.getElementById('min').addEventListener('click', () => {
- const {getCurrentWindow} = require('@electron/remote')
- getCurrentWindow().minimize()
+ const {ipcRenderer} = require('electron')
+ ipcRenderer.send("siyuan-cmd", "minimize");
})